51,511 Shares in Aemetis, Inc $AMTX Acquired by State of Wyoming

State of Wyoming bought a new position in shares of Aemetis, Inc (NASDAQ:AMTXFree Report) during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or bought 51,511 shares of the specialty chemicals company’s stock, valued at approximately $90,000. State of Wyoming owned 0.10% of Aemetis at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Activity

In other news, Director Francis P. Barton sold 26,452 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Thursday, August 14th. The shares were sold at an average price of $2.53, for a total value of $66,923.56. Following the completion of the sale, the director owned 208,518 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$527,550.54. This represents a 11.26% decrease in their position. Aemetis Stock Performance

Shares of Aemetis stock opened at $2.26 on Tuesday. Aemetis, Inc has a 52-week low of $1.22 and a 52-week high of $4.73. The stock has a market capitalization of $142.92 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-1.40 and a beta of 1.34. The company has a fifty day moving average of $2.77 and a 200-day moving average of $2.10.

Aemetis (NASDAQ:AMTXG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 7th. The specialty chemicals company reported ($0.41)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.35) by ($0.06). The firm had revenue of $52.24 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$78.68 million. On average, equities research analysts forecast that Aemetis, Inc will post -2.07 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Aemetis Profile

Aemetis, Inc operates as a renewable natural gas and renewable fuels company. It operates through three segments: California Ethanol, California Dairy Renewable Natural Gas, and India Biodiesel. The company focuses on the operation, acquisition, development, and commercialization of technologies to produce low and negative carbon intensity renewable fuels that replace fossil-based products.
